Display mA
This menu displays the mA output of each of the installed output modules in the
information display. In the screen example, the first output is selected (using the
“Display mA” key) and indicates 20 mA. Up to seven outputs can be installed. This
feature can be helpful for output signal loop tests to remote equipment.

Digital inputs
Signal and zero position are multiple choice list fields. These inputs can start a
calibration cycle, or switch on and off an output hold module. The inputs are polled
once a second and any change of status must apply for at least one second to be
recognized by the system.
